Network Security Threats (Malware)

Cards (6)

  • Malware: Software that is designed to cause harm or damage to a computer.
  • Trojan - Pretending to be legitmate software; so they are downloaded as if they are good., they dont replicate.
  • Viruses - replicate themselves and attach to files and modify, delete or copy data.
  • Worms - Self-replicate without user and spread through emails.
  • Ransomware - Holding unauthorised data and in return get money for release.
  • Spyware - Secretly monitoring user activicties.
